400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el为什么自动就关闭了

作者:路由通
|
199人看过
发布时间:2026-02-23 23:43:37
标签:
当Excel软件在使用过程中突然自动关闭,通常意味着程序遭遇了无法自行处理的错误。这种非正常退出的背后,往往与系统资源冲突、软件自身缺陷、文件损坏或外部程序干扰等多种因素有关。本文将深入剖析导致Excel自动关闭的十几个核心原因,并提供一系列经过验证的解决方案与预防措施,帮助用户彻底排查问题根源,恢复稳定高效的工作流程。
excel为什么自动就关闭了

       在日常办公中,没有什么比正在紧张处理数据时,眼前的Excel(电子表格)窗口突然毫无征兆地消失更让人沮丧的了。这种“自动关闭”的现象,轻则打断工作思路,重则可能导致未保存的劳动成果付诸东流。许多用户将其简单归咎于“软件崩溃”,但实际上,这背后隐藏着一个错综复杂的原因网络。作为一名资深的编辑,我接触过大量相关案例,并深入研究过微软(Microsoft)官方技术文档。今天,我们就来系统地拆解这个问题,从表层现象直抵问题核心,并提供一套完整的问题诊断与修复指南。

       资源瓶颈与系统环境冲突

       首先,我们必须将视线投向运行Excel的计算机本身。软件并非运行在真空中,它与操作系统和其他程序共享着有限的硬件资源。当资源被过度消耗或发生争用时,Excel就可能因“力不从心”而被迫退出。

       其一,内存(随机存取存储器)不足是经典诱因。如果你同时打开了多个大型工作簿,或者工作簿中包含大量公式、数据透视表、高清图片和复杂图表,这些都会持续占用大量内存。当物理内存和虚拟内存都濒临耗尽时,Windows操作系统为了维持系统稳定,可能会强制关闭占用资源最多的应用程序,而Excel往往首当其冲。你可以通过任务管理器查看内存使用率,如果长期超过85%,就需要警惕了。

       其二,中央处理器负载过高。复杂的数组公式、大量跨工作簿的链接、正在运行的宏脚本,都会让处理器满负荷运转。如果此时处理器温度过高或因其他程序(如杀毒软件全盘扫描)也在抢占资源,系统稳定性下降,也可能导致Excel意外关闭。

       其三,与显卡驱动程序的兼容性问题。现代Excel版本(特别是支持三维地图、平滑动画的版本)会调用图形处理器进行加速渲染。过时、损坏或与当前系统不兼容的显卡驱动程序,可能在处理某些图形元素时引发冲突,直接导致程序崩溃。定期更新显卡驱动至官方稳定版是良好的习惯。

       其四,系统组件损坏。微软的分布式组件对象模型等技术框架是Excel正常运行的基础。这些系统文件可能因软件卸载不干净、病毒破坏或意外断电而损坏,进而影响依赖它们的应用程序。

       软件自身缺陷与配置不当

       排除了外部环境问题,接下来就要审视Excel软件本身及其设置。

       其五,程序文件损坏或安装不完整。这是最常见的原因之一。安装包下载不完整、安装过程中被中断、或关键的系统更新未能正确应用,都可能导致Excel的可执行文件或动态链接库文件损坏。轻微损坏可能只是让某个功能失效,严重损坏则直接引发启动或运行时的崩溃。

       其六,加载项冲突。加载项是用于扩展Excel功能的插件,它们由微软或第三方开发者提供。某些加载项可能存在设计缺陷,或者与当前Excel版本不兼容。当Excel启动或执行特定操作(如点击某个菜单)时,有问题的加载项会引发连锁反应,导致主程序关闭。安全模式下启动Excel(按住Ctrl键启动)可以暂时禁用所有加载项,是判断此问题的有效方法。

       其七,软件版本存在已知漏洞。没有任何软件是完美的,微软会定期发布更新来修复安全漏洞和程序错误。如果你长期未更新,可能正在使用一个包含会导致崩溃缺陷的版本。通过微软官方渠道保持更新至关重要。

       其八,默认文件关联或注册表项异常。Windows通过注册表记录Excel的安装路径、文件关联等信息。如果这些条目被其他软件错误修改或损坏,系统在调用Excel时可能指向错误的位置或参数,从而无法正常启动程序。

       工作簿文件的内在问题

       有时,问题不出在环境或软件,而出在你正在处理的那个特定文件上。工作簿文件本身可能“带病”。

       其九,工作簿文件结构损坏。这是导致Excel在打开或保存特定文件时崩溃的元凶之一。文件可能因存储介质(如优盘)读写错误、网络传输中断、保存时突然断电或病毒侵袭而损坏。损坏可能发生在存储公式的区段、样式定义区域或图表数据部分。尝试用“打开并修复”功能(在文件打开对话框中点击“打开”按钮旁的下拉箭头选择)往往能解决部分问题。

       其十,文件内容过于复杂或存在“隐形”错误。一个工作簿如果包含数以万计的跨表引用、定义名称过多过滥、使用了已被淘汰的函数、或者存在循环引用而未被正确提示,都会让Excel的计算引擎不堪重负,最终可能选择崩溃来“逃避”。此外,某些从网页或其他软件复制粘贴过来的内容,可能携带了异常的格式代码,埋下了不稳定的种子。

       其十一,宏代码错误。对于启用了宏的工作簿,如果其中的VBA(Visual Basic for Applications)宏代码存在逻辑错误、调用了不存在的对象或方法、或陷入了死循环,当宏运行时,就可能引发未处理的运行时错误,导致Excel停止响应并关闭。在宏代码中加入完善的错误处理语句是开发者的责任。

       其十二,与特定功能的兼容性问题。如果你使用的文件是在更新版本的Excel中创建并保存了某些新特性(如新的函数或图表类型),而在旧版本中打开,旧版本可能无法解析这些新内容,从而引发崩溃。反之,旧文件在新版本中打开,虽然兼容性一般较好,但也并非全无风险。

       外部程序干扰与用户操作习惯

       电脑是一个协同工作的生态系统,其他程序的干扰不容忽视。

       其十三,安全软件过度防护。杀毒软件或防火墙有时会误将Excel的正常操作(尤其是涉及宏或外部数据连接时)判定为可疑行为,从而拦截甚至终止其进程。将Excel或信任的宏文件添加到安全软件的白名单中,可以避免此类误杀。

       其十四,与其他办公软件的冲突。虽然微软办公软件套装设计为协同工作,但个别时候,同时运行的多个办公组件(如Outlook、Word)可能会在调用共用资源时产生冲突。此外,一些第三方办公软件或文档管理工具如果安装了系统级插件,也可能与Excel产生干涉。

       其十五,用户操作习惯引发的连锁反应。频繁且快速地执行一系列复杂操作(如连续使用撤销/重做、快速切换工作表、同时编辑多个单元格),尤其是在硬件配置较低的电脑上,可能使Excel的界面响应线程与计算线程产生冲突,增加程序不稳定的风险。养成定时保存的习惯(或开启自动保存),能最大程度减少损失。

       系统性的诊断与修复策略

       面对自动关闭问题,盲目尝试不可取。一套系统性的诊断流程能帮你高效定位问题。

       首先,进行基础排查。重启电脑,这能释放被占用的资源并重置一些临时状态。尝试打开其他Excel文件或新建空白工作簿,如果只有特定文件出问题,则重点怀疑该文件损坏或内容过载。如果所有文件都出问题,则可能是软件、加载项或系统环境问题。

       其次,利用安全模式诊断。如前所述,在安全模式下启动Excel,这会禁用所有加载项和自定义设置。如果在安全模式下运行稳定,则基本可以确定是某个加载项惹的祸。你可以通过“文件”->“选项”->“加载项”,逐一禁用并重启测试,找出问题加载项。

       第三,修复Office安装。在Windows控制面板的程序和功能中,找到Microsoft Office,选择“更改”,然后选择“快速修复”或“联机修复”。这可以自动检测并修复损坏的程序文件,过程安全且不会影响你的文档。

       第四,检查并更新。确保Windows操作系统和Excel都已更新到最新版本。同时,访问电脑制造商或显卡厂商官网,更新关键的硬件驱动程序。

       第五,处理问题文件。对于怀疑损坏的文件,使用“打开并修复”功能。如果无效,可以尝试将内容复制到新建的工作簿中:有时仅复制单元格值(选择性粘贴为值)和格式,分批进行,可以绕过损坏的部分。对于包含宏的文件,可以尝试在VBA编辑器中检查并调试代码。

       第六,调整Excel选项。在“文件”->“选项”->“高级”中,可以尝试暂时禁用图形硬件加速、将计算模式改为手动、或减少“最多撤销次数”。这些调整有时能绕过特定的兼容性问题。

       如果以上方法均告无效,作为最后的手段,可以考虑完全卸载并重新安装Office套件。在卸载前,请确保备份好所有个人文档和自定义模板。

       培养防患于未然的习惯

       与其在崩溃后焦头烂额,不如提前建立防线。养成以下习惯,能极大提升工作的稳定性。

       务必开启“自动保存”或“自动恢复”功能,并将时间间隔设置为10分钟或更短。定期手动保存,可以使用快捷键。在开始处理大型或复杂项目前,先保存一个副本。避免在移动存储设备上直接编辑文件,应先复制到本地硬盘。保持工作簿的“整洁”,定期清理不再使用的定义名称、样式和隐藏工作表。对于极其重要的工作,考虑使用版本控制或云同步服务,保留历史版本。

       总而言之,Excel自动关闭并非无解之谜。它像一次程序发出的“求救信号”,提示我们在资源管理、软件维护、文件操作或系统协同的某个环节出现了纰漏。通过理解其背后的多层次原因,并掌握从简到繁的排查方法,我们不仅能解决眼前的问题,更能构建一个更稳定、高效的数字工作环境,让Excel真正成为可靠的得力助手,而非焦虑的来源。

相关文章
为什么WORD有半夜无法写字
许多用户反映其使用的文字处理软件在深夜时段偶现无法输入文字的困扰。本文将深入剖析这一现象背后可能存在的十二个核心原因,从软件后台维护机制、系统资源调度冲突到个人电脑的节电设置等层面进行系统性探讨。文章旨在通过援引官方技术文档与常见问题解决方案,为用户提供一份详尽、专业且具备实操价值的深度解析,帮助读者理解问题本质并找到相应的应对策略。
2026-02-23 23:43:34
271人看过
ndis驱动如何调试
网络驱动接口规范(NDIS)驱动调试是网络开发中的核心技术挑战。本文将系统阐述其调试环境搭建、工具链使用、常见问题诊断与高级调试技巧,涵盖从内核调试器配置到数据包分析的全流程。内容基于微软官方技术文档与实践经验,旨在为驱动开发者提供一套可操作的专业解决方案。
2026-02-23 23:43:25
291人看过
如何理解力矩
力矩是物理学中描述力对物体转动作用的核心概念,其本质是力与力臂的乘积。理解力矩不仅需要掌握其定义与计算公式,更关键在于领会其作为矢量所蕴含的方向性及其在平衡状态下的动态意义。本文将从基本定义出发,逐步深入探讨力矩的矢量特性、杠杆原理的现代诠释、右手定则的应用,并系统分析其在静力学平衡、工程机械、生物力学乃至天体运动中的广泛实践。通过结合生活实例与权威物理原理,旨在构建一个从基础到前沿的完整认知框架,帮助读者透彻理解力矩如何支配从微观到宏观的旋转世界。
2026-02-23 23:43:16
292人看过
为什么excel加插后排序不了
当我们在表格处理软件中插入新行或新列后,尝试对数据进行排序时,操作却常常失效,这背后涉及数据区域的界定、单元格格式的冲突、隐藏对象的干扰以及软件本身的逻辑设定等多重复杂原因。本文将系统剖析十二个核心症结,并提供一系列经过验证的解决方案,帮助您彻底理顺数据,恢复流畅的排序功能。
2026-02-23 23:43:15
71人看过
如何加载skill脚本
技能脚本作为自动化任务与扩展功能的核心载体,其加载过程是开发者必须掌握的基础操作。本文旨在提供一份从概念理解到实战应用的详尽指南。文章将系统阐述技能脚本的本质、典型应用场景,并深入解析多种主流环境下的加载方法与技术细节,涵盖从基础的本地文件加载到复杂的网络动态加载等十二个关键方面,辅以代码示例与最佳实践,帮助读者构建清晰、完整的知识体系与实践能力。
2026-02-23 23:43:06
310人看过
ad 丝印如何设置
本文将深入探讨在电子设计自动化软件中设置丝印层的完整流程与核心技巧。文章从丝印层的基本概念与重要性入手,系统性地解析了从软件参数配置、元件标识符调整、到文字与图形布局优化的全链路操作方法。内容涵盖了对齐网格、设置字体与线宽、规避焊盘与过孔、处理高密度设计等十二个关键实践环节,旨在帮助工程师高效、规范地完成印刷电路板设计中的丝印层设置,从而提升电路板的生产质量与后期调试便利性。
2026-02-23 23:43:01
233人看过